The Shipyard Museum is dedicated to the time when the city's shipyard built ships and the working class grew. Helsingør Værftsmuseum is the story of toil, noise, dirt, pride and unity in a bygone era when the shipyard whistle ruled the town. Economically, employably, socially, culturally and politically, the shipyard was the natural focal point.
Guided tour
Groups can come outside opening hours by appointment. A guided tour with a former shipyard worker costs DKK 600 for groups up to 10 people and DKK 800 for groups larger than 10 people. Entrance fees are included in the price.
